Pasmick wins twice for swimmers

by Tom Coombe
Northeast Range/Ely had five first-place finishes, including two by Brooke Pasmick, in a 56-38 loss at Eveleth-Gilbert.
The high school girls swimming team was very competitive with the host Golden Bears, as Pasmick’s second win of the Sept. 28 meet - which came in the 100 backstroke - pulled the Nighthawks to within four points.
Eveleth-Gilbert rebounded with one-two finishes in the meet’s final two events to secure the win.
Brooke Pasmick swam to victory in both the 100 backstroke (1:15.35) and the 100 freestyle (1:03.98), while her sister Laura topped the field in the 500 freestyle with a time of 7:07.60.
Kayla Mellesmoen (60 freestyle) and Kelly Thompson (200 freestyle) also picked up individual wins, while Maarja Faltesek (160 individual medley) and Tesla Humphreys (100 butterfly) came home with second-place finishes.
Amanda Carey had a hand in three firsts for the Golden Bears.
